Tour Overview and Pricing

The 1-Day Private Sightseeing Tour in Hiroshima and Miyajima Island is priced from $490.00 per group, which can accommodate up to 8 participants.

The tour includes guiding fees, tour arrangement, lunch, transportation during the tour, and entrance fees to Shukkeien garden, Hiroshima Peace Museum, and the ferry to Miyajima Island.

Travelers can take advantage of free cancellation up to 24 hours before the experience starts. Confirmation is received at the time of booking, ensuring a hassle-free planning process.

Accessibility and Transportation Options

1-day-private-sightseeing-tour-in-hiroshima-and-miyajima-island

The tour isn’t wheelchair accessible, but it’s located near public transportation options.

Travelers will need to have moderate physical fitness to participate in the day’s activities. While private transportation can be arranged upon request, many visitors found the public transport system to be sufficient for getting around.

The tour takes travelers to several sites, including the Hiroshima Peace Park and Miyajima Island, which may involve walking over uneven terrain.

Potential Variability in Service Quality

1-day-private-sightseeing-tour-in-hiroshima-and-miyajima-island

While the tour is highly recommended, some reviews suggest potential variability in the quality of service provided.

A few travelers have noted:

  • Issues with the organization of the tour, such as long waits for museum tickets
  • Unexpected additional costs that weren’t clearly communicated upfront
  • Guides who, while knowledgeable, lacked the personal narratives and engaging storytelling that enhanced the experience for others
  • Concerns about the value for money, with some feeling the tour was overpriced for the services delivered
  • Challenges with accessibility and physical demands of the activities, which may not suit all visitors

Despite these occasional issues, the tour remains a unique opportunity to explore Hiroshima and Miyajima Island with expert guidance.
